A DevOps engineer is creating a CodePipeline service role. The above IAM policy is attached to the role. The pipeline fails when trying to download artifacts from the S3 bucket. What is the issue?

The policy is missing s3:ListBucket permission on the bucket.
The pipeline fails because the IAM policy grants s3:GetObject on the object ARN but lacks s3:ListBucket on the bucket ARN. CodePipeline's S3 artifact download action first calls ListBucket to verify the bucket exists and the object key is accessible before performing the GetObject call. Without s3:ListBucket, the initial validation fails, causing the pipeline to error out even though GetObject is allowed.

Under the hood, CodePipeline uses the S3 GetObject API to download artifacts, but the AWS SDK or CLI first performs a HeadBucket or ListObjectsV2 call to validate the bucket and key path. Without s3:ListBucket, the pipeline receives an AccessDenied error during the validation step, which is logged as a 'permission denied' failure. In real-world scenarios, this often occurs when engineers grant only object-level permissions (s3:GetObject) and forget the bucket-level list permission, especially when using cross-account S3 buckets where bucket policies also require explicit ListBucket grants.

AWS S3 Storage Class Comparison
Storage Class
Min Duration
Retrieval
Use Case
S3 Standard
None
Immediate
Frequently accessed data
S3 Standard-IA
30 days
Immediate
Infrequent access, rapid retrieval
S3 One Zone-IA
30 days
Immediate
Non-critical infrequent data
S3 Intelligent-Tiering
None
Immediate–hours
Unknown or changing access patterns
S3 Glacier Instant
90 days
Milliseconds
Archive with instant retrieval
S3 Glacier Flexible
90 days
Minutes–hours
Archive, flexible retrieval
S3 Glacier Deep Archive
180 days
Hours
Long-term compliance archive
